About This Home
Charming cul-de-sac home, prime West Hills location! This 2225 sqft, freshly painted beauty features 4 spacious bedrooms, 2.5 baths, and a wealth of storage throughout. The open-concept living area boasts a large family room and living room, perfect for relaxation and entertainment. The kitchen features double oven, and ample space for culinary delights. The real showstopper is the seamless transition from the living and dining areas with sliding glass doors to the stunning backyard oasis. With its expansive grassy area, seating space, covered patio, and BBQ, you'll love spending time outdoors. Imagine hosting your New Year's party in this beautiful home! The backyard is perfect for alfresco dining, parties, and making memories. This move-in ready property includes closets in every bedroom, ample storage throughout, and a convenient cul-de-sac location. Plus, it's situated in a family-friendly area with top-rated schools nearby including Justice Charter Elementary and El Camino Real Charter High school. Close access to Westfeild Topanga, The Village, Topanga Social and lots of hiking trails nearby. Don't miss out on this fantastic opportunity to make this charming home yours! MLS# SR25275705

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
